The Mechanics of Mobile Payments: Apple Pay and Google Pay Explained
At their core, Apple Pay and Google Pay leverage Near Field Communication (NFC) technology for in-person transactions and tokenization for online payments. This sophisticated security measure replaces sensitive card details with a unique, encrypted token, rendering the actual card number inaccessible to merchants or online casinos. This fundamental aspect is what makes these payment methods particularly appealing to experienced gamblers who prioritize data protection.
Tokenization and Enhanced Security
When you use Apple Pay or Google Pay, your actual credit or debit card number is never shared with the casino. Instead, a device-specific account number (for Apple Pay) or a virtual account number (for Google Pay) is used. This tokenization process significantly reduces the risk of data breaches, as even if a casino’s system were compromised, the stolen tokens would be useless without the corresponding device and authentication. This layer of security is a crucial advantage over traditional card payments, where your full card details are transmitted.
Seamless Integration and User Experience
Both Apple Pay and Google Pay are designed for intuitive use. Once your cards are linked to your digital wallet, making a deposit at an online casino becomes a matter of a few taps or clicks, often authenticated by Face ID, Touch ID, or a PIN. This eliminates the need to repeatedly enter card numbers, expiry dates, and CVV codes, saving valuable time and reducing the potential for input errors. For the experienced gambler, this efficiency translates to more time focused on gameplay and less on administrative tasks.
Advantages for the Experienced Gambler
The benefits of utilizing Apple Pay and Google Pay extend beyond basic security and convenience, offering specific advantages that resonate with seasoned players.
Expedited Deposits and Withdrawals
Time is often of the essence in online gambling. Apple Pay and Google Pay facilitate almost instantaneous deposits, allowing players to fund their accounts and engage in gaming without delay. While withdrawal speeds are often dictated by the casino’s internal processing times and KYC (Know Your Customer) procedures, many platforms prioritize payouts to these digital wallets, often resulting in quicker access to winnings compared to bank transfers or traditional card withdrawals.
Enhanced Privacy
By acting as an intermediary between your bank and the casino, Apple Pay and Google Pay add an extra layer of privacy. Your bank statements will typically show transactions to Apple Pay or Google Pay, rather than directly listing the online casino. This can be a desirable feature for players who prefer to maintain discretion regarding their gambling activities.
Cross-Device Compatibility
Whether you prefer to gamble on your iPhone, iPad, Android smartphone, or desktop computer, Apple Pay and Google Pay offer consistent functionality. This cross-device compatibility ensures a seamless experience regardless of your chosen platform, a significant advantage for players who frequently switch between devices.
Budget Management Tools
While not directly integrated into the payment methods themselves, the digital wallet apps often provide a clear overview of your transaction history. This can be a valuable tool for experienced gamblers who diligently track their spending and adhere to responsible gambling practices. By easily reviewing deposits made through these platforms, players can maintain better control over their bankroll.
Considerations and Potential Limitations
While the advantages are numerous, experienced gamblers should also be aware of certain considerations when using Apple Pay and Google Pay at online casinos.
Availability at Casinos
Despite their growing popularity, not all online casinos have fully integrated Apple Pay and Google Pay as payment options. Players should always verify the available payment methods before registering with a new casino. The trend, however, is towards broader adoption, so this limitation is gradually diminishing.
Withdrawal Options
While deposits are generally straightforward, some casinos may not support withdrawals directly back to Apple Pay or Google Pay. In such cases, players might need to opt for alternative withdrawal methods, such as bank transfers or e-wallets, which could introduce additional processing times or fees. It is crucial to review a casino’s withdrawal policy thoroughly before making a deposit.
Device Dependency
The primary functionality of Apple Pay and Google Pay is tied to your mobile device. While some desktop browsers support these methods, the most fluid experience is typically on a smartphone or tablet. For players who predominantly gamble on desktop, this might be a minor consideration, though most modern online casinos are designed with mobile-first principles.
Regional Restrictions
The availability and specific functionalities of Apple Pay and Google Pay can vary by region. While widely supported in Denmark, players traveling or operating from different jurisdictions should be mindful of potential regional limitations on these payment services.
